The Inspection Process
A critical first step for any experienced exterminator is a comprehensive inspection of your property. This allows them to:
- Identify the specific species of rat involved.
- Pinpoint entry points and pathways the rats are using to access your home or business.
- Assess the extent of the infestation and the level of damage that may have occurred.
- Evaluate potential food and water sources attracting the rodents.
Treatment and Removal Strategies
Based on the inspection findings, your local Westfield rat control professional will develop a tailored treatment plan. Common and effective methods often include:
- **Strategic Placement of Baits and Traps:** Utilizing rodenticides and various types of traps (snap traps, glue traps, live traps) in discreet yet accessible locations where rat activity is high.
- **Exclusion Techniques:** This involves identifying and sealing off entry points such as cracks in foundations, gaps around pipes, vents, and damaged window screens. Preventing new rats from entering is as crucial as removing existing ones.
- **Habitat Modification:** Providing advice on how to eliminate or reduce attractants like accessible garbage, pet food, and clutter around your property, which is particularly important in a suburban setting like Westfield.
- **Sanitation and Cleanup:** Often, professionals will offer advice or services related to cleaning up droppings and nesting materials, which can carry diseases.

How do I know if I have rats or mice in my Westfield home
Rats are generally larger than mice, have longer tails, and their droppings are typically about the size of a raisin or a kernel of corn, whereas mouse droppings are much smaller and pointed. You might also notice more substantial gnaw marks on items in your home. If you hear scurrying sounds in walls or attics, especially at night, it could indicate a rat presence. Professionals can confirm the species during an inspection.
Are rat extermination services in Westfield safe for my family and pets
Reputable rat exterminators prioritize the safety of your family and pets. They use rodenticides and other treatment methods in accordance with strict safety protocols. Baits are often placed in tamper-resistant bait stations, and professionals will advise you on any necessary precautions to take during and after the treatment process. Open communication with your chosen exterminator about your concerns is key.
What can I do to prevent rats from returning after extermination
Prevention is a collaborative effort. After professional extermination, it’s vital to maintain a rodent-proof environment. This includes sealing potential entry points around your home, storing all food in airtight containers (both indoors and outdoors, including pet food), keeping your yard clean and free of debris that can provide shelter, and ensuring garbage bins have tight-fitting lids. Professionals can offer specific recommendations tailored to your property in Westfield.
